Abstract
In this article electronic electricity meters are considered. Indications of various types of meters in the presence of harmonious components of voltage and a current in a circuit are estimated. The error of measurements depending on various making harmonics are compared. It has been shown that the higher harmonics essentially influence indications of various types of electricity meters of reactive energy that can lead to undesirable consequences at payment of electric energy by the consumer.
